Buildtech rebrands, expands

Published: 16 October 2013
A Bulawayo retailer specialising in building material and industrial products is expanding its operations by opening more branches. Formerly known as Buildtech Building and Industrial Merchants, the company has rebranded to Dee-Bee Hardware, the name of the parent company.

The operations director, Mr Huitsimang Dube, said they were in the process of expanding the business and the rebranding was part of the process.

"The rebranding process has already started. We opened a branch in Gwanda on 1 August and another one here in Bulawayo at Fort Street on 1 September," he said.

Mr Dube said the company had been operating at a corporate market level catering mainly for corporate companies but now wanted to expand into the cash market.

"We want to expand into the cash market whereby we will supply everyone even someone who comes in without having placed an order," he said.

He said that the product profile had not changed.

"We are not changing our product profile or anything else, the only thing that is changing is the trade name," said Mr Dube.

He said that as they were expanding, they wanted to avoid using many different names which will end up confusing clients.

"As we are growing and expanding, we want to avoid using different names that is why we decided to rebrand our trading name to be the same with the name of the company to keep one identity," he said.

"It is due to the company's vision for growth that the subsidiaries or trading names should take after the main company name that is Dee-Bee Eng (Pvt) Ltd, trading as Dee-Bee Hardware. The future is looking at Dee-Bee Transport, Timbers, Mineral resources and the list goes on."
